1. Harnessing Agri-Focused Initiatives

Agriculture-themed programs connect 12 million farmers to platforms, driving 30% of rural GMV through direct farm-to-buyer links.

1.1 “Help the Farmers” Enrollment Pinduoduo’s free training teaches listing optimization for produce, yielding 40% sales jumps via targeted feeds. Sellers gain access to premium slots, bypassing ad fees. Overseas brands can join as suppliers, bundling tools with local yields for hybrid offerings.

1.2 Seasonal Campaign Alignments Time listings to planting cycles with flash group buys, capitalizing on post-harvest cash flows. This strategy has doubled off-season revenues in pilots. Use platform calendars to schedule, incorporating weather APIs for timely promos.

2. Cultivating Community Endorsements

Peer networks amplify reach, with 65% of rural buys influenced by village shares in 2025.

2.1 KOL Village Alliances Recruit local influencers for co-lives, blending seller stories with product spotlights to hit 50k views per session. Authenticity drives 28% conversion uplifts. Overseas brands collaborate by providing samples, co-scripting culturally attuned content.

2.2 Review Incentive Loops Reward verified buyers with credits for dialect videos, building social proof that algorithms favor. Loops have sustained 35% retention in co-ops. Monitor via sentiment tools, featuring top reviews in listings.

3. Streamlining Supply Chain Digitization

C2M models cut middlemen, enabling 20% margin gains for rural producers.

3.1 Factory-Direct Integrations Link village workshops to Pinduoduo’s C2M for custom runs based on buyer data, scaling small batches efficiently. This has revitalized 600k merchants. Overseas brands feed designs, localizing via joint prototypes.

3.2 Inventory Forecasting Tools Adopt free SaaS from JD for demand predictions, averting stockouts during festivals. Accuracy hits 85%, per user reports. Train via webinars, adjusting for regional trends like lunar buys.

4. Diversifying Across Multi-Platform Matrices

Omnichannel presence on Taobao, JD, and Douyin hedges risks, capturing 80% of rural traffic.

4.1 Cross-Listing Automation Use APIs to sync inventories across sites, maintaining consistent pricing for group deals. This matrix boosts exposure by 25%. Overseas brands sync via shared dashboards, unifying branding.

4.2 Hybrid Offline-Online Events Host village fairs with QR codes funneling to apps, blending touchpoints for 40% trial-to-sale rates. Events double community ties. Plan with local govs, tracking footfall conversions.

5. Embracing Sustainability Certifications

Green badges appeal to 55% of buyers, unlocking subsidies and premium pricing.

5.1 Eco-Traceability QR Codes Embed blockchain tags for origin stories, verifying sustainable sourcing to lift trust 30%. Platforms subsidize certifications. Overseas brands certify imports, co-labeling for joint appeals.

5.2 Waste-Reduction Partnerships Collaborate on upcycling programs, turning scraps into listings for 15% ancillary revenue. Initiatives align with 2025 regs. Pilot with NGOs, measuring impact via sales uplift.

Case Study: Yiwu’s Artisan Collective on JD Rural

In Zhejiang’s Yiwu, a 2024-launched collective of 200 rural artisans transitioned to JD’s rural program, specializing in eco-bags from recycled textiles. By mastering cross-listings and KOL lives, they hit RMB 50 million in sales within a year, employing 500 locals and exporting designs globally.
